## Further Reading

The Brightfall crash-report pipeline ingests symbolicated reports from both the Lumora iOS and Android builds, deduplicates them, and routes high-volume signatures to the Triage Desk queue. Support staff do not need pipeline access to answer most tickets, but understanding retention windows and symbolication delays helps set customer expectations. The full architecture overview, retention policy, and escalation matrix are documented on the internal wiki page here:

wiki page, bagaf-fawip: https://harbor.tolvaqsys.local/pages/repo/pages/secrets/eac969ffc71f356b

Hi,

As discussed, we completed the cut-over of mobile deep-link routing from the legacy Fennelgate router to the new Lintermill resolver last night. All app-scheme and universal-link traffic now flows through Lintermill; the legacy path is disabled but not yet decommissioned, pending your sign-off. Fallback routes were verified on both platforms and no routing errors surfaced in the first twelve hours. For your security review, the production routing configuration now in effect is below.

service settings:
PRAIX_LOG_LEVEL=error
PRAIX_METRICS_HOST=metrics.praix.qorvelcorp.corp
PRAIX_POOL_SIZE=16

**Runbook: consent banner rollout (Claripane)**

Roll out region by region, starting with the Vessmark cluster. Flag name is consent_banner_v2; keep the kill switch armed for 48 hours. Verify the banner logs acceptance events to the compliance sink before widening. The sink rejects unauthenticated writes, so the banner service needs its write credential set in the .env file, immediately below this line.

secret setting of bajeg-yahog: LEDGER_TOKEN20=f833f3e2e6625ec0dee3

**Moving the Quarterly Stock-Count Ledger.** Heads up: the Q3 ledger for the Pellbrook depot goes out as a single bound volume, not loose sheets, so don't let anyone "helpfully" photocopy pages before the run. It rides in the orange satchel from the counting office, zipped and strapped. Schedule it as the first drop of the morning so the Ardsley finance team can reconcile by noon. The specific hand-over instruction for the courier is appended just below.

courier memo of yawep-yafog: the pramir ulaix courier leaves the ulavan aldix frair zorok oliiel joreth rusdor fenvan ledger at gate 1305 under passcode 514738